Habitat Comparison
Greater White-fronted Goose
Breeds on Arctic and subarctic tundra and peatlands. Winters on estuaries, agricultural fields, freshwater marshes, and flooded meadows across Europe, Asia, and North America. One of the most widespread geese.
Garganey
Breeds on freshwater marshes, flooded meadows, and lake margins in Eurasia from Europe east to Siberia. Winters across sub-Saharan Africa, the Indian subcontinent, and Southeast Asia in wetlands of all kinds.
Song & Call Comparison
Greater White-fronted Goose
A loud, laughing 'kow-lyuk' or musical 'wah-wah'. Gives a distinctive high-pitched yodeling quality lacking in Greylag. Highly vocal in large winter flocks.
Garganey
Male produces a distinctive mechanical rattle or craking sound; female gives a subdued quack. The rattling male call is unlike any other teal and immediately diagnostic.

How to Tell Them Apart
Greater White-fronted Goose
Brown-gray body with white forehead patch bordered by white band at bill base. Underparts with bold irregular black bars on belly. Orange bill; orange-yellow legs. Juveniles lack white front and …
Garganey
Breeding males have chocolate-brown head with sweeping white supercilium. Blue-gray forewing; green speculum with white border. Gray flanks with white vermiculations. Females brown with white loral stripe.

Garganey
A small migratory teal. Males are unmistakable with a broad white supercilium, chocolate-brown head, and bluish-grey wing coverts. The only Eurasian duck that is fully migratory, wintering in Africa and South Asia. Breeds across Eurasia; one of the most long-distance migrant ducks.
